facular

adj. meaning bright and magnetic, from the latin, facula, literally meaning "little torch" or "bright spot". Also coming from faculae (n.) which describes a bright spot in an image, or a sun spot produced by extreme concentrations of magnetic force.
After a wonderful planning session, the team was very optimistic about forging a new, facular future.
